Top Heritage Sites in Jaipur to Explore on a Royal Enfield
1. Amer Fort
One of Jaipur’s most iconic landmarks, Amer Fort is a must-visit for every traveler. Built in the 16th century, Amer Fort stands majestically on a hill, overlooking Maota Lake. The fort’s architectural grandeur and scenic location are best experienced in the early morning. Arriving on a Royal Enfield allows you to skip the parking hassle, and the winding road leading up to the fort provides a thrilling ride.
- Tip: Visit early in the morning to avoid crowds and capture stunning photographs of the fort under the golden sunrise.
2. Nahargarh Fort
Situated on the Aravalli Hills, Nahargarh Fort offers panoramic views of Jaipur and is perfect for a scenic bike ride. The route to Nahargarh is steep, making the powerful engine of a Royal Enfield essential. Once at the top, you can explore the fort's intricate architecture and enjoy a quiet moment with a breathtaking view of the city below.
- Highlight: Sunset at Nahargarh is an unforgettable experience, with the city lights of Jaipur twinkling below as day turns to night.
3. City Palace
Located in the heart of Jaipur, City Palace is a splendid blend of Mughal and Rajput architecture. Riding a bike gives you the freedom to explore the streets surrounding City Palace, where you’ll find charming bazaars and local eateries. Inside the palace, discover the history of Jaipur through its museums, artwork, and the opulent Peacock Gate.
- What to See: The Diwan-i-Khas (Hall of Private Audience) and the famous Chandra Mahal, which houses royal artifacts.
4. Hawa Mahal
Known as the Palace of Winds, Hawa Mahal is an architectural marvel with its pink sandstone façade and lattice windows. Since it’s situated on a bustling main road, arriving by bike makes it easier to park and enjoy this remarkable sight. Snap photos of the palace and then wander through the surrounding markets for a taste of Jaipur’s vibrant shopping culture.
- Nearby Attractions: Johari Bazaar and Sireh Deori Market are just a short walk away, making this a perfect stop to shop for traditional jewelry, textiles, and handicrafts.
5. Jantar Mantar
An astronomical observatory and UNESCO World Heritage Site, Jantar Mantar is a must-visit for history and science enthusiasts. Built by Maharaja Sawai Jai Singh II, this complex houses the world’s largest stone sundial. Arriving here on a Royal Enfield ensures you have a unique way of experiencing one of Jaipur’s finest architectural achievements.
- Fun Fact: Jantar Mantar features massive instruments that calculate time, predict eclipses, and track celestial bodies.
Preparing for Your Ride Through Jaipur
Plan Your Route in Advance
Jaipur’s bustling streets and narrow lanes can be challenging to navigate. Use maps or a GPS device to plan your route beforehand, especially if you’re aiming to visit multiple sites in a single day. Map out fuel stations and places to stop for food and water along the way.
Check the Weather
Jaipur’s climate can be hot and dry, especially in the summer months. Check the weather forecast and dress appropriately. Riding in the early morning or late afternoon can help you avoid the intense midday heat.
Respect Local Traffic Rules
Traffic in Jaipur can be chaotic, so always follow local traffic rules. Ride at a safe speed, especially when navigating crowded areas or around tourist spots.
Best Time to Explore Jaipur on a Royal Enfield
The best time to visit Jaipur is during the winter months, from October to March, when the weather is cooler and more pleasant. Avoid the peak summer months, as temperatures can reach upwards of 45°C (113°F). The monsoon season, from July to September, brings occasional rains, which can make riding a bit challenging.

Dining Options and Rest Stops Along the Way
Riding through Jaipur is bound to build up an appetite. Fortunately, there are several rest stops and eateries near the city’s major heritage sites. Here are a few recommendations:
- 1135 AD (Amer Fort): Enjoy traditional Rajasthani cuisine with a stunning view inside Amer Fort.
- Padao Restaurant (Nahargarh Fort): This rooftop café serves snacks and drinks, offering a perfect rest stop with a view.
- LMB (Laxmi Misthan Bhandar): A popular spot near City Palace and Hawa Mahal, known for its sweets and Rajasthani thalis.
